Joel Richter

Joel Richter

University of Massachusetts Chan Medical School, USA

Joel D. Richter is a Professor of Molecular Medicine and the Arthur F. Koskinas Professor in Neuroscience at the University of Massachusetts Chan Medical School. Richter and his laboratory defined cytoplasmic polyadenylation and the RNA binding protein CPEB as being instrumental in translational control in early development and in the brain. More recently, they have demonstrated that Fragile X Syndrome, a neurodevelopmental disorder, is in part caused by mis-splicing of FMR1 RNA. This mis-splicing event is corrected by antisense oligonucleotide (ASO) administration, suggesting a possible novel therapeutic advance to treat this disease.
